A Legacy Etched in Stone: The Origins of the Akbash Dog


The Akbash Dog's lineage stretches back millennia, interwoven with the nomadic tribes that traversed the Anatolian plateau.

Archaeological evidence suggests that these dogs have guarded livestock since at least 2000 BC,

with depictions found on ancient Hittite and Assyrian tablets. Their development remained largely untouched by outside influence, resulting in a breed perfectly adapted to the harsh Anatolian environment.

Built for Endurance: The Physical Prowess of the Akbash Dog


The Akbash Dog is a giant among guardian breeds. Standing at a height of 28-34 inches and weighing between 100-150 pounds, they possess a powerful build characterized by broad chests, strong legs, and a thick double coat. This coat, typically white or cream colored, provides insulation against the scorching sun and frigid Anatolian winters. Their imposing presence is a formidable deterrent to predators, while their keen eyesight and hearing allow them to stay vigilant over vast territories.



A Shepherd's Stalwart Companion: The Akbash Dog's Temperament


Despite their imposing size, the Akbash Dog is known for its calm and even temperament. They are fiercely loyal to their charges, forming strong bonds with the sheep, goats, or cattle they protect. Akbash Dogs are independent thinkers, capable of making decisions on their own when safeguarding their flock. Their natural instincts make them highly suspicious of strangers, and they will bark readily to alert their owners of any potential threats.



Living with a Gentle Giant: Is the Akbash Dog Right for You?


The Akbash Dog's loyalty and protectiveness are undeniably attractive qualities. However, their independent nature and large size make them a challenging breed for first-time dog owners. Akbash Dogs require experienced handlers who can provide them with firm but fair training. They have a strong need for space and exercise, thriving in environments where they can perform their guarding duties. Living in an apartment or a small house is not a suitable environment for this breed.
